What is the origin of OTT platforms?

OTT started as an internet-based alternative to traditional broadcasting.

As content became available through portable devices,

the user base grew rapidly.

As outdoor activities decreased during COVID,

OTT usage increased dramatically.

What are free streaming services?

Free platforms allow viewing in return for advertisements.

Content becomes accessible without subscription fees.

FAST services are becoming more popular.

Both users and providers benefit from the ad model.
